The PI3A3899ZTEX belongs to the category of electronic components.
It is primarily used for signal switching and routing in electronic circuits.
The PI3A3899ZTEX is available in a small surface-mount package.
This product serves as a key component in electronic systems, enabling efficient signal management and control.

The PI3A3899ZTEX utilizes advanced semiconductor technology to enable fast and reliable signal switching. It operates based on the principles of solid-state electronics, utilizing MOSFET transistors to control the flow of signals through the different channels.
